The city today reported 114 new coronavirus cases, the biggest single-day spike yet.

An 82-year-old man from Burail died of the virus at the Government Medical College and Hospital, Sector 32, last night, making him the 30th fatality of the UT. He died of respiratory failure due to a complex lung injury that the infection had caused.

The coronavirus tally of the city has now reached 2,216. About 45 per cent of the cases are still active. The new cases have been reported from Sector 7, 38, 4, 35, 45, 48, 34, 27, 49, 15, 63, 50, 23, 42, 14, 49, 44, 40, 37, 22, 10, 12, 23, 33, 47, 19, 50, 26, 20, 41, 38 (West), 52, 32, 29, Khuda Ali Sher, Ram Darbar, Mani Majra, Behlana, Mauli Jagran, Daria, Dadu Majra, Khuda Lahora, Dhanas,Hallo Majra, Behlana, Industrial Area and Kishangarh.
